New York - Andre Agassi says that while he misses his tennis career only in some ways, he undoubtedly misses the US Open.
The two-time champion was inducted Sunday into the US Open Court of Champions at Arthur Ashe Stadium before the women's final.
The 42-year-old Agassi competed in the tournament a men's Open-era record 21 consecutive times, from 1986 through 2006. It was the only Grand Slam event he never skipped, and he tells the New York fans, "The reason, quite honestly, is you."
During the ceremony, the recently retired Andy Roddick paid tribute to the lessons Agassi taught him.
